Explore printable Electric Power and Dc Circuits worksheets for Year 10

Electric power and DC circuits worksheets for Year 10 students available through Wayground (formerly Quizizz) provide comprehensive coverage of fundamental electrical concepts that form the foundation of advanced physics study. These expertly designed worksheets guide students through calculating electrical power using P=IV, P=I²R, and P=V²/R formulas while exploring the relationships between voltage, current, and resistance in direct current circuits. Students develop critical problem-solving skills by analyzing series and parallel circuit configurations, determining total resistance, and calculating power dissipation across individual components. Each worksheet includes detailed practice problems that progress from basic power calculations to complex multi-step circuit analysis, with complete answer keys provided to support independent learning and self-assessment. These free printable resources strengthen mathematical application skills while building conceptual understanding of how electrical energy transforms into other forms of energy in practical circuits.
